ServiceNow Sourcing and Procurement Operations description

ServiceNow Sourcing and Procurement Operations helps businesses streamline their buying process from request to purchase. The software offers tools to digitize and automate tasks like creating purchase orders, managing approvals, and tracking spending. This allows employees to make purchases themselves through pre-approved channels and gives management better visibility into company spending. ServiceNow Sourcing and Procurement Operations is a good fit for mid-sized to large companies looking to reduce costs and increase efficiency in their purchasing departments.

ServiceNow Sourcing and Procurement Operations alternatives

  • Logo of ProSpend
    ProSpend
    Better for mid-sized businesses. Has expense reporting, virtual cards, and AP automation on a single platform. Growing faster.
    Read more
  • Logo of SAP Ariba Buying and Invoicing
    SAP Ariba Buying and Invoicing
    Has broader company size applicability. Is growing faster in terms of web traffic and employee growth. Supports document management. A strong ServiceNow Sourcing and Procurement Operations competitor.
    Read more
  • Logo of Pivot
    Pivot
    Better fit for small businesses and growing tech companies. Offers a user-friendly interface, seamless integrations, and strong customer support. Has more momentum currently. Focuses on budget management and Procure-to-Pay. Lacks robust reporting and sourcing features.
    Read more
  • Logo of Precoro
    Precoro
    Better for small to mid-sized businesses. Has more momentum.
    Read more
  • Logo of SAP Concur
    SAP Concur
    Better for travel and expense management. A mobile app supports receipt capture. Has broader industry applicability. Shows some negative momentum.
    Read more
  • Logo of ProQsmart
    ProQsmart
    Better for managing complex projects and large purchases. More suitable for construction and manufacturing industries. Grows faster.

  • How does ServiceNow Sourcing and Procurement Operations integrate with other tools?

    ServiceNow Sourcing and Procurement Operations integrates with other ServiceNow products and third-party applications. It connects with ERP, accounting, and other enterprise systems to enable seamless data flow and process automation across the organization.
